U.S. State Department Inherits Woes
of Mid East as Feldman Resigns

By MILTON FRIEDMAN

(Copyright, 1965, JTA, Inc.)

WASHINGTON — The Johnson
administration has now reverted
to the philosophy of the Eisen-
hower administration by turning
the Arab-Israel problem complete-
ly over to the State Department.
President Johnson feels that spe-
cial intercession for Israel on a
White House staff level is no
longer needed. He decided against
designating a replacement for
Myer Feldman, White House spe-
cial counsel, who resigned re-
cently. Mr. Feldman advised both
President Kennedy and Mr. John-
son on the Israeli side of issues—
supplying information and aspects
the State Department chose to
ignore.
The State Department is com-
mited to pursuit of improved re-
lations with Egypt's Nasser—if
necessary, at the expense of Is-
rael. The Department is con-
vinced that Nasser represents
the wave of the future in the
Near East. Egyptian-American
relations are deemed more im-
portant than the fate of Israel.

mand — the initial step toward
war."
He pointed out that the Arabs
"are building sophisticated wea-
pons like guided missiles" and are
obtaining ultra-modern tanks, sub-
marines, and jet bombers from
the Soviet Union. "They have ob-
tained financing for military
equipment from oil-rich members
of the unified command," he said.

Mr. Feldman asserted that the
Arabs have "a diabolical plan for
the diversions of Israel's vital water
resources—and they have actually
embarked on this project." He
c alle d for increased American
vigilance, in view of tendencies in
the Arab world. In his view, "Arab
morale was strengthened to dan-
gerous proportions by their suc-
cess in getting West Germany to
halt arms shipments to Israel."
Mr. Weidman warned that Jor-
dan has grown belligerent despite
"every effort at peaceful solutions
to irritations along its 500-mile
border with Israel." He also cau-
tioned against "an Egypt sharpen-
ing its instruments of war against
Israel in Yemen and the Congo."
He called for vigilance and as-
sertion of views by supporters of
Israel.

NEW YORK (JTA)—Aryeh L.
Pincus, treasurer of the Jewish
Agency, in Jerusalem, told Amer.
scan Zionists that the Zionist
movement must find its way to the
college campus.

Speaking at a reception at the

Hotel Astor given by the Labor
Zionist Organization of America,

in honor of Marie Syrkin on the
occasion of her recent election to
the Jewish Agency executive, Pin-
cus said that the campus today is
the Zionist movement's major

front.
Marie Syrkin, who is associate
professor of English at Brandeis
University, said that she hoped to
reach youth in every possible way.
Prof. Syrkin is editor of the Jewish
Frontier, monthly magazine of the
Labor Zionist Organization. She is

the author of a number of works,
including a biography of Israel
Foreign Minister Golda Meir.
